Former President Olusegun Obasanjo, Nobel Laureate Prof. Wole Soyinka, and legal icon Dr. Wale Babalakin were among several dignitaries who paid glowing tributes to the late former Governor of Oyo State, Dr. Victor Omololu Olunloyo, as final burial rites commenced with a symposium in Ibadan.
Olunloyo, who passed away on April 6 at the age of 90, was remembered as a rare intellectual force whose brilliance spanned academics, politics, and leadership.
Speaking as chairman of the event, Obasanjo described Olunloyo as not just a scholar and man of letters, but a true genius. He recounted fond memories of their long-standing relationship and the depth of Olunloyo’s intellect.
“With Omololu, anything he touched, he did with ease—almost too easily,” Obasanjo said. “He studied engineering and yet excelled as a mathematician. It all came naturally to him, like play.”
He added that beyond Olunloyo’s intellectual prowess, he had a unique personality: “You couldn’t talk about Omololu without acknowledging that side of him many described as political rascality or playfulness. I actually enjoyed that side. He would always appear unserious at first, but what came out of him was always profound and deeply serious.”
Obasanjo recalled their time in the old Western Region government in 1965, under General Adebayo, where Olunloyo’s political allegiance was difficult to classify. “He wasn’t clearly for either Awolowo or Akintola—he was somewhere in between. But that was Omololu: deeply independent in thought.”
He described Olunloyo as “a very serious man wrapped in layers of brilliance, wit, and intellect that only a few could truly understand.”
Also speaking at the event, Prof. Wole Soyinka hailed Olunloyo as a “mathematical genius whose legacy will remain indelible.” He noted that Olunloyo’s impact in academia and politics was profound and far-reaching.
Dr. Wale Babalakin, Global President of the Government College Ibadan (GCI) Old Boys Association—Olunloyo’s alma mater—described the late governor as “a genius among geniuses.” He praised GCI for producing exceptional minds, saying, “There is no secondary school in Nigeria that has produced more geniuses than ours. We’re proud to count Olunloyo among our own.”
Other dignitaries in attendance included the Olubadan of Ibadanland, Oba Owolabi Olakulehin; President-General of the Central Council of Ibadan Indigenes (CCII), Barrister Niyi Ajewole; Senator Kola Balogun; and former Chief of Staff to Governor Seyi Makinde, Chief Bisi Ilaka, among others.
